Shane Warne’s ex-wife is the happiest she’s ever been after transformi­ng her body and mindset with yoga, since splitting with Australia’s King of Spin more than a decade ago.

Opening up, Simone Callahan says she struggled to cope with the attention that came with being part of one of Australia’s most famous couples and found their marriage “repressive”.

“I didn’t really enjoy that time in the spotlight... The person I wanted to be was suppressed a little bit, through everything that happened,” the 48-year-old, who shares three kids, Brooke, 21, Jackson, 19, and Summer, 16, with Shane, told A Current Affair. “I tend to shy away from all of it.”

It’s no secret that Simone’s 10-year marriage to Shane was fraught with heartache thanks to the cricketer’s extramarit­al antics.

As well as a series of highprofil­e affairs, Warnie was famously sacked as vice-captain for sending a string of “dirty texts” to a British nurse and allegedly asked another woman for a foursome with England batsman Kevin Pietersen, all while married with two children.

After divorcing Shane in 2005, Simone briefly took him back only to have her heart broken again when he sent a flirtatiou­s text message to his wife that he intended for another woman.

FINDING PEACE

But now all those years of heartache are well and truly behind her. Thirteen years on fromher from her divorce, Simone has found peace through yoga, teaching the ancient discipline six times a week at a studio in Melbourne’s Brighton.

“I just used to see yogis... and thought they looked so peaceful and calm, and I wanted to feel that way. It’s been very good for me, for calming myself,” says Simone who first took up the workout regimen 15 years ago, when she started “going through stuff with Shane and I wasn’t really coping”.

In fact the practice, which originates in India, has even helped Simone forge a strong friendship with her ex-husband, allowing her to let go of the hurt and anger she was holding on to.

“It instils a lot of good in you through the poses and the shifting of energy and not holding on to stuff,” she says.

The former WAG even recently travelled to India’s Rishikesh, the birthplace of yoga, to deepen her knowledge. As well as feeling mentally stronger, Simone has never looked better. Swapping the red carpet for yoga is clearly paying off, as her 8000 and counting Instagram followers can attest to.
